found: Work cat: Le château et la citadelle de Saumur: architecture du pouvoir, 2010:p. 7 (Château de Saumur rebuilt in the last part of the XIV century on the base of the Capetian fortress ...) p. 225 (Château de Saumur, which is built on the crest of a hill and encased in a Protestant citadel, with the city and the royal river at its feet, the monument creates a very strong impression today. Portrayed in all its splendour in the "Très Riches Heures" of the Duke of Berry, Saumur is among the sites that embody the medieval castle in popular imagination)
